Originally established by the Connecticut General Assembly as the Storrs Agricultural School in 1881, it became the Connectiucut State College in 1933 and the Universit yof Connecticut in 1939.(See link, below, for more UConn history.)

The first five colonies established in North America were Virginia,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, Maryland, and Connecticut. Virginia, founded in 1607, was the first permanent English colony. Massachusetts followed in 1620 with the Pilgrims, and Maryland was established in 1634 as a refuge for Catholics. New Hampshire and Connecticut were settled in the early 1630s by groups seeking religious freedom and economic opportunities.
